The famed painter Hieronymus Bosch portrayed medieval life brimming withs ymbolism, fantasy and riddles. Commemorating the five hundredth anniversary of the artist's death the RCO commissioned Detlev Glanert to write a requiem for soloists, choir, organ and orchestra. The composition translates the demonic nature of Bosch's paintings with textual counterparts into music. Glanert combines traditional requiem texts with excerpts from the manuscript collection Carmina Burana - each movement of the Requiem is accompanied by a poem about the seven deadly sins.
